Description

This tutorial presents optomechanical modeling techniques to effectively design and analyze high-performance optical systems. It discusses thermal and structural modeling methods that use finite-element analysis to predict the integrity and performance of optical elements and optical support structures. Includes accompanying CD-ROM with examples.

Contents

- Introduction to Mechanical Analysis Using Finite Elements
- Optical Fundamentals
- Optomechanical Displacement Analysis Methods
- Integrated Optomechanical Analyses
- Modeling the Effects of Temperature
- Adaptive Optics Analysis Methods
- Optimization of Optomechanical Systems
- Example Telescope Analysis
- Integrated Optomechanical Analysis of a Lens Assembly
